What Is a Robot Vacuum?
A robot vacuum is an automated, autonomous cleaning device designed to carry out various cleaning tasks, normally focused on floor surface areas. They are geared up with sensing units, brushes, and motors that allow them to navigate around spaces, prevent obstacles, and clean effectively. The arrival of smart home technology even more improves these devices' capabilities, enabling users to integrate them into their home automation systems.

How Robot Vacuums Work
Understanding how a robot vacuum operates can assist users maximize its potential. Below is a simplified summary of the working mechanism:

Sensors:
Robot vacuums are equipped with numerous sensors to prevent crashes and navigate around furnishings. Infrared and cliff sensing units prevent them from falling off stairs.

Navigation and Mapping:
Basic designs may utilize random navigation patterns, while advanced designs use advanced mapping technology to create a design of the home. They can determine locations that need particular attention, improving total efficiency.

Cleaning Mechanisms:
Robot vacuums use brushes or rollers to agitate dirt and debris, allowing the suction motor to collect the particles into a dustbin. Some include HEPA filters to trap irritants.

Recharge Cycle:
When the battery runs low, the robot vacuum can go back to its docking station autonomously to recharge, guaranteeing it's always ready for its next cleaning session.

Robot vacuums can considerably decrease the frequency of conventional vacuuming, however they might not totally change them due to limitations on deep cleaning and bigger debris. Lots of people utilize both for ideal results.

How do I keep my robot vacuum?
Regular maintenance consists of clearing the dustbin, cleaning the filters, and checking the brushes for hair and particles. Periodically, users might need to upgrade firmware.
